    Help Needed Re PTA Model Number


    For ordering an aftermarket bolt handle, what "Savage model #" is correct for my Precision Target Action? It's a short action, S/N K2985XX.

    Your bolt handles are pretty well standard. Just order one for a Savage Model 10, 110, or a Precision Target Action and it will fit. There's one bolt handle for Savage Right Hand Right Eject Actions.

    Model 16 or 116 will be stainless. Model 10, 11, 12 or 14 and 110, 111, 112, or 114 will be either matte or gloss depending on the factory part number. Any aftermarket bolt handle for those model numbers will fit your PTA.

    Correct, the handle itself may look different, or may be made with different material, but the mount pattern is the same, so they all will fit all.
